An IDP is an official translation of your national driver's license into multiple languages, recognized under the 1949 and 1968 UN road-traffic conventions. It doesn't replace your home license — it travels beside it, so police and rental desks abroad can read your credentials in a format they already trust. They're the same document under different names. There is no standalone “international license” that lets you drive worldwide on its own — every legitimate version is an IDP that accompanies your valid national license. If a seller promises a permit that fully replaces your home license, treat that as a red flag, not a feature.

No — an IDP proves your right to drive, not your identity. It's a driving credential, so keep your passport for identification and your national license for the underlying license itself. The IDP simply makes both readable to officials abroad.
An IDP isn't an insurance document, but it often matters for one. Many insurers and rental policies only pay out if you were legally permitted to drive at the time — and in countries that require an IDP, driving without one can void that cover. Carrying it helps keep your insurance valid; always read your specific policy for the details.

Hand over your IDP together with your national license and passport. The IDP translates your details into the officer's language — which is exactly what it's built for. It turns a confusing roadside stop into a routine one.
In countries that require an IDP, driving without one can mean on-the-spot fines, a refused rental, or voided insurance if you're in an accident. Even where it isn't strictly mandatory, not having one is the most common reason travelers lose their rental booking at the counter. The downside is rarely worth the small saving.
Yes — as long as your national license already covers that vehicle category. The IDP mirrors the classes on your home license; it can't grant permissions you don't already hold, so make sure your license includes motorcycles before you ride.
Around 75 countries do — including the UK, Ireland, Japan, Australia, New Zealand, Thailand, India, South Africa, and much of the Caribbean and East Africa. Your IDP is valid regardless of which side they drive on; it's worth a quick read of local rules before you set off so the change of side doesn't catch you out at the first junction.
Yes, every time you drive. The IDP is only valid in the same wallet as your national license — it translates that license, it doesn't stand in for it. Leave the original at the hotel and your IDP loses its standing.
